Re: [心得] Zmud en技能自動更新使用等級之法

看板mud_sanc (Sanctuary - 聖殿)作者 (sanc小牧師)時間17年前 (2008/09/06 22:11), 編輯推噓11(11013)
留言24則, 5人參與, 最新討論串2/2 (看更多)
感謝作者提出用法,我貼一下我的實作案例 首先是en自動換級 (自創技能要回天空城en,不適合放入) pattern: 你的技能,『%1』進步了{(}%d00{)} commands: #var skillname %1 #if (@skillname = "柔道") {enable judo} #if (@skillname = "劍道") {enable kendo} #if (@skillname = "半月斬") {enable hafe blade} #if (@skillname = "小醉拳") {enable drink fist} #if (@skillname = "太極拳") {enable taichi fist} #if (@skillname = "SM技巧") {enable SM} #if (@skillname = "神射手ψ") {enable shooter} #if (@skillname = "舞燄之斧") {enable fire axe} #if (@skillname = "美女拳法") {enable girl fist} #if (@skillname = "打狗棒法") {enable pkdog rod} #if (@skillname = "王者之路") {enable king-road} #if (@skillname = "多重攻擊") {enable multi_att} #if (@skillname = "如來神掌") {enable zulai fist} #if (@skillname = "百花棍法") {enable flower rod} #if (@skillname = "武臨斧斬") {enable wu-lin axe} #if (@skillname = "隱刃之術") {enable hide dagger} #if (@skillname = "武當劍法") {enable wudon slash} #if (@skillname = "少林拳法") {enable soulin fist} #if (@skillname = "飄零之卷") {enable drift volume} #if (@skillname = "迴槍刺擊") {enable return lance} #if (@skillname = "落日刀法") {enable sunset blade} #if (@skillname = "冰燄杖法") {enable icefire wand} #if (@skillname = "霸王槍技") {enable overload lance} #if (@skillname = "星光杖法") {enable starlight wand} #if (@skillname = "飄雲杖法") {enable fly-cloud wand} #if (@skillname = "戰龍之斧") {enable war-dragon axe} #if (@skillname = "焚城槍法") {enable burn-city lance} #if (@skillname = "水蓮劍法") {enable water-lotus slash} #if (@skillname = "騎士風斬法") {en knight slash} #if (@skillname = "佛山無影腳") {enable fosan foot} #if (@skillname = "彩虹七色劍") {enable rainbow slash} #if (@skillname = "閃華裂光拳") {enable sankalekouken} #if (@skillname = "雪月凝風斬") {enable snow-moon blade} 再來是自動補heart pattern: 你的%1效果消失了。 commands: #if (%1 = "界王拳") {heart kaioken} #if (%1 = "易筋經") {heart egingin} #if (%1 = "龍鬥氣") {heart drafight} #if (%1 = "盜賊之心") {heart thief} #if (%1 = "刀者意志") {heart blade} #if (%1 = "氣功心法") {heart brave} #if (%1 = "內功心法") {heart fister} #if (%1 = "騎士之魂") {heart knight} #if (%1 = "劍士之心") {heart slasher} #if (%1 = "戰士之心") {heart fighter} #if (%1 = "信仰之心") {heart clerical} #if (%1 = "意念控制") {heart int control} #if (%1 = "爆力手臂") {heart bakunetsu_arm} #if (%1 = "煙嵐之篆") {heart vapor calligraphy} #if (%1 = "魔力釋放術") {heart magic} #if (%1 = "魔力操控術") {heart magic} #if (%1 = "加強殺傷力") {heart damage} #if (%1 = "冒險者之心") {heart adventure} #if (%1 = "狂暴之吼") {heart damage heart violent-shout} 以上是使用中的觸發,能改善的話請多指教 -- 体は 剣で 出来ている 血潮は鉄で 心は硝子 幾たびの戦場を越えて不敗 ただの一度も敗走はなく ただの一度も理解されない 彼の者は常に独り 剣の丘で勝利に酔う 故に、生涯に意味はなく その体は きっと剣で出来ていた -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 220.133.103.102

09/06 22:49, , 1F
狂暴之吼只要設在加強殺傷力後方即可,不須分開
09/06 22:49, 1F

09/06 22:49, , 2F
有效時間是一樣的吧!
09/06 22:49, 2F

09/06 22:50, , 3F
放在戰鬥開始咩...
09/06 22:50, 3F

09/06 22:51, , 4F
建議還是套入Var中,再比對Var的值較佳,不然程式會
09/06 22:51, 4F

09/06 22:52, , 5F
認錯,觸發一大堆不相關的EN技
09/06 22:52, 5F

09/06 22:52, , 6F
暴力手臂可以heart??我都不知道耶!
09/06 22:52, 6F

09/06 22:57, , 7F
好像不行!
09/06 22:57, 7F

09/06 23:01, , 8F
以前可以..
09/06 23:01, 8F

09/06 23:03, , 9F
寫成case也許更好....
09/06 23:03, 9F

09/06 23:24, , 10F
果然改了就不會當了
09/06 23:24, 10F
※ 編輯: bahatest 來自: 220.133.103.102 (09/06 23:26)

09/06 23:27, , 11F
狂暴之吼隔一秒是因為sanc的heart會全部同時消失
09/06 23:27, 11F

09/06 23:28, , 12F
然後如果狂暴之吼消失的字比加強殺傷力早出就會失敗
09/06 23:28, 12F

09/06 23:29, , 13F
所以我狂暴之吼都是消失隔一秒放
09/06 23:29, 13F

09/07 08:53, , 14F
狂暴之吼前補個加強殺傷力也OK
09/07 08:53, 14F

09/07 09:21, , 15F
更新一下...heart不能用var...會把整片command帶入
09/07 09:21, 15F

09/07 09:21, , 16F
造成當機
09/07 09:21, 16F

09/07 10:37, , 17F
基本上 那麼多判別程式 也很容易當機...
09/07 10:37, 17F
※ 編輯: bahatest 來自: 220.133.103.102 (09/07 10:38)

09/07 10:39, , 18F
感覺還好ㄝ...雖然說把觸發全砍了CPU負擔最小
09/07 10:39, 18F

09/07 10:40, , 19F
要不就客製化吧,只留自己要的部分
09/07 10:40, 19F

09/07 11:22, , 20F
int contorl 不能heart
09/07 11:22, 20F

09/07 15:30, , 21F
你把patten的%1改成(%1)看看,我的很正常沒問題!
09/07 15:30, 21F

09/07 15:39, , 22F
內功心法還是不行,damage取消var就好了
09/07 15:39, 22F

09/07 16:14, , 23F
加強的加這個字會吃字
09/07 16:14, 23F

09/11 21:42, , 24F
不想再修改的觸發請把"能改善的話請多指教"刪掉
09/11 21:42, 24F
文章代碼(AID): #18me-btk (mud_sanc)
文章代碼(AID): #18me-btk (mud_sanc)